Comprehending The Different Types Of Hernia Surgery
There are numerous reasons for an individual to undergo Hernia surgical treatment, yet recognizing the various types of Hernia surgery is crucial prior to going under the blade. On one hand, there can be a basic solution with laparoscopic Hernia repair, while on the various other end of the range, facility ruptures could require more intrusive methods.
The laparoscopic method includes making a number of tiny incisions in the abdominal area as well as placing an electronic camera as well as tools to fix the Hernia. This can be performed in an outpatient setup with minimal disturbance to daily life after that. Nevertheless, some intricate ruptures may require open surgery through a solitary large incision in order to correctly resolve the concern. In these situations, clients will certainly often face a much longer recuperation time than with laparoscopy as well as may need to remain in the health center for several days or weeks during recovery.
No matter which type of Hernia surgical procedure is essential, it is very important for people to recognize all their choices as well as any prospective threats involved so they can make an enlightened choice concerning their therapy.

Threats associated with Hernia surgery include infection, bleeding, nerve damage and also organ injury. The sort of surgical treatment will establish which dangers may be applicable; as an example, laparoscopic surgical procedures have fewer dangers than open surgical treatments. You need to also consider any underlying problems that might increase the danger throughout or after the procedure such as diabetic issues or obesity. Consult with your medical professional about any worries as well as make sure you're aware of every little thing prior to dedicating to anything.
On the other hand, there are some significant benefits associated with Hernia fixing surgical procedure. Commonly reported favorable results include discomfort alleviation and enhanced lifestyle overall-- plus, it can aid prevent future complications like bowel blockage or strangulation which can be life-threatening in severe instances.
